To obtain the most up-to-date information on the current political situation in South Africa, you can follow these steps:

1. Check Reliable News Sources: Begin by visiting reputable news outlets that cover South African politics. These may include international news organizations such as BBC News, Reuters, and Al Jazeera, as well as local South African news outlets like News24, Eyewitness News, and TimesLIVE. These sources often provide the latest updates on political developments, policy changes, and other relevant information.

2. Access Government Websites: Visit the official websites of the South African government, such as the Presidency of the Republic of South Africa, the Ministry of Communications and Digital Technologies, or the South African Parliament. These websites often provide press releases, speeches, and other official statements regarding the political situation in the country.

3. Monitor Social Media: Follow verified accounts of political leaders, government officials, and political parties on platforms like Twitter, Facebook, or Instagram. These platforms can provide real-time news, statements, and opinions on the current political landscape in South Africa.

4. Consult Research and Analysis Platforms: Explore research organizations or think tanks that focus on South African politics. Organizations like the Institute for Security Studies and the South African Institute of International Affairs often publish reports, policy briefs, and analysis on the political situation in the country.

By utilizing these steps and staying informed through reliable sources, you can gather details and updates on the current political situation in South Africa.
